Quote: In 1666, Isaac Newton used a prism to disperse white light and produce the now familiar spectrum of seven colors--red, orange, yellow, green, blue, indigo, and violet--that he himself named. (Feel free to call them Roy G. Biv.) Other people had played with prisms before. What Newton did next, however, had no precedent. He passed the emergent spectrum of colors back through another prism and recovered the pure white he had started with. This simple exercise demonstrated a remarkable property of light that has no counterpart on the artist's palette--where these same colors of paint, when mixed, leave you with a sludge-colored glob. Further, Newton tried to disperse each of the spectrum's seven colors, but he found them to be pure. The human eye has no capacity to do what prisms do.
